Struct druid::widget::ProgressBar

source ·
pub struct ProgressBar;
Expand description

A progress bar, displaying a numeric progress value.

This type impls Widget<f64>, expecting a float in the range 0.0..1.0.

fn build_widget(state: &Params) -> Box<dyn Widget<AppState>> {
    let mut flex = match state.axis {
        FlexType::Column => Flex::column(),
        FlexType::Row => Flex::row(),
    }
    .cross_axis_alignment(state.cross_alignment)
    .main_axis_alignment(state.main_alignment)
    .must_fill_main_axis(state.fill_major_axis);

    flex.add_child(
        TextBox::new()
            .with_placeholder("Sample text")
            .lens(DemoState::input_text),
    );
    space_if_needed(&mut flex, state);

    flex.add_child(
        Button::new("Clear").on_click(|_ctx, data: &mut DemoState, _env| {
            data.input_text.clear();
            data.enabled = false;
            data.volume = 0.0;
        }),
    );

    space_if_needed(&mut flex, state);

    flex.add_child(
        Label::new(|data: &DemoState, _: &Env| data.input_text.clone()).with_text_size(32.0),
    );
    space_if_needed(&mut flex, state);
    flex.add_child(Checkbox::new("Demo").lens(DemoState::enabled));
    space_if_needed(&mut flex, state);
    flex.add_child(Switch::new().lens(DemoState::enabled));
    space_if_needed(&mut flex, state);
    flex.add_child(Slider::new().lens(DemoState::volume));
    space_if_needed(&mut flex, state);
    flex.add_child(ProgressBar::new().lens(DemoState::volume));
    space_if_needed(&mut flex, state);
    flex.add_child(
        Stepper::new()
            .with_range(0.0, 1.0)
            .with_step(0.1)
            .with_wraparound(true)
            .lens(DemoState::volume),
    );

    let mut flex = SizedBox::new(flex);
    if state.fix_minor_axis {
        match state.axis {
            FlexType::Row => flex = flex.height(200.),
            FlexType::Column => flex = flex.width(200.),
        }
    }
    if state.fix_major_axis {
        match state.axis {
            FlexType::Row => flex = flex.width(600.),
            FlexType::Column => flex = flex.height(300.),
        }
    }

    let flex = flex
        .padding(8.0)
        .border(Color::grey(0.6), 2.0)
        .rounded(5.0)
        .lens(AppState::demo_state);

    if state.debug_layout {
        flex.debug_paint_layout().boxed()
    } else {
        flex.boxed()
    }
}
